Dental Implant Options

We offer a full range of implant solutions tailored to your needs:

Single-Tooth Implants

Replace one missing tooth with a natural-looking and permanent solution.

Implant Bridges

Secure multiple missing teeth without relying on neighboring teeth.

All-on-4 or All-on-X Implants

Restore your entire upper or lower arch using 4 to 6 implants to support a full set of teeth—stable, beautiful, and long-lasting.

Snap-On Implant Dentures

Removable dentures anchored with implants for added security and comfort.

The Implant Journey: What to Expect

Our Comprehensive Process for Successful Dental Implants

Consultation and Planning

Start with a free consultation where you'll meet our in-house specialists, take photos, and discuss your dental needs. We evaluate your teeth, review treatment options, and answer all your questions. Using X-rays and detailed planning, we ensure your implants will be perfectly integrated and secured to your jawbone.

Implant Placement

We surgically place the titanium implant into your jawbone, creating a stable foundation for your new tooth. After the implant is placed, we allow time for it to integrate with the bone, ensuring a secure fit.

Abutment and Crown Placement

Once the implant has healed, we attach the abutment and custom-made crown. This final step restores the natural look and function of your tooth, completing your smile transformation.

How much do dental implants cost in Orange County?

The cost of dental implants can range from $3,000 to $6,000 per tooth, depending on the complexity of the procedure and any additional treatments, like bone grafting. Multi-tooth implants, such as implant-supported bridges or full arch replacements (like All-on-4), can cost significantly more.

Is All-on-X better than traditional dentures?

Yes—All-on-X offers a permanent, secure, and natural-feeling solution using 4–6 implants to support a full arch. No adhesives, no slipping.

Who is a good candidate for All-on-4 dental implants?

Patients missing most or all teeth who have sufficient bone or are eligible for bone grafts are ideal candidates. A consultation with our prosthodontist can confirm.

How long does the implant process take?

Single implants typically require 3–6 months including healing. All-on-X cases may offer same-day temporary teeth with full healing over several months.

What’s the success rate of dental implants?

With proper planning and care, dental implants have a 95–98% success rate and can last decades—or a lifetime.

Are dental implants painful?

Most patients say it's easier than expected. We use local anesthesia or sedation for your comfort, and healing is usually mild.

Will my insurance cover implants?

Dental implant coverage depends on your insurance plan. While many dental insurance plans don’t fully cover implants, they may cover portions like extractions or crowns. Medical insurance might help if the implant is necessary due to an injury. We can help check with your provider and verify your coverage.
